What is a registration assistant?

Registration Assistants are administrative professionals who help manage the registration process for events, courses, hospitals, or organizations. Their responsibilities typically include collecting and verifying information, assisting clients or participants with forms, maintaining accurate records, and providing customer service. They play a vital role in ensuring that registration procedures run smoothly and efficiently. Strong communication, attention to detail, and organizational skills are important for success in this role.

How does a registration assistant typically collaborate with other departments during busy registration periods?

During peak registration times, Registration Assistants work closely with departments such as Admissions, Student Services, and IT to ensure a smooth process for all registrants. They help resolve data discrepancies, clarify student information, and coordinate solutions for technical issues. Effective communication and teamwork are essential, as Registration Assistants often serve as the first point of contact for new students and must relay information accurately between departments to prevent delays.

What is the difference between Registration Assistant vs Patient Registrar?

AspectRegistration AssistantPatient Registrar
C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; some roles may require certificationHigh school diploma; certification may be preferred
Work EnvironmentHospitals, clinics, healthcare officesHospitals, outpatient clinics, healthcare facilities
Job ResponsibilitiesAssisting with patient check-in, data entry, schedulingRegistering patients, verifying insurance, managing patient records
Industry UsageCommonly used in healthcare settings for administrative supportMore specialized role focusing on patient registration and data management

While both roles involve patient data and administrative tasks in healthcare, a Registration Assistant typically provides general support with check-in and scheduling, whereas a Patient Registrar handles detailed registration, insurance verification, and record management. The roles often overlap but differ in scope and responsibilities.

What are the responsibilities of a registration assistant?

A registration assistant is responsible for verifying and recording participant or patient information, managing registration forms, and ensuring data accuracy. They often use computer systems or databases to input and update records and may assist with scheduling appointments or providing customer service. Attention to detail and good organizational skills are essential for this role.
